At Early Intervention for Autism, we believe all children can learn and are dedicated to helping children with special needs meet their full potential.

Our mission is to help children with special needs achieve their full potential by teaching them the way that they learn best. We develop an individual-based program specifically designed to meet the unique needs of each child, utilizing Applied Behavioral Analysis (ABA) therapy to improve life skills, academic skills, communication, and social skills. We work with children and their families where they are and where they live: in the home, in the schools, and in the community.

Our Integrity team wanted to share the link to these printable Halloween trick-or-treat cards by Cari Ebert Seminars.🎃

Cari explains that when trick-or-treating, a child with ASD can show the front side of these cards that says “Trick-or-Treat” and after receiving a goodie, they can flip the lanyard over to the side that says “Thank you!”
